linux中mmap()函数。

2019-03-26 12:30发布

我刚接触linux编程,关于mmap()系统调用中void* mmap(void* start,size_t length,int prot,int flags,int fd,off_t offset);这个offset是相对与start的偏移量么?如果是的话这个offset没有什么太大的存在意义,直接把起始地址设置为从offset出开始就行了,何必再加个offset呢?
此帖出自Linux与安卓论坛
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
1条回答
spacexplorer
1楼-- · 2019-03-26 20:15
这个问题,真的没有研究过,或许你是对的,不过,我们通常在用这种系统函数时候都是参考模板来的,根本没有时间去深究。。。

一周热门 更多>